Wrexham County Borough Council
Rate: £33.00 per hour PAYE / £44.23 per hour Umbrella
Contract: Ongoing Temporary Assignment
Hours: Full-Time
Service Care Solutions are currently recruiting for an experienced Adults Social Worker to join the Safeguarding & Mental Health Team at Wrexham County Borough Council.
This is an excellent opportunity for a skilled Social Worker with experience in adult safeguarding and mental health services to join a supportive local authority team committed to delivering high-quality outcomes for vulnerable adults.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age a caseload of adults requiring safeguarding and mental health interventions.
- Undertake assessments, reviews and support planning in line with statutory duties.
- Complete safeguarding enquiries and risk assessments.
- Work collaboratively with health professionals, partner agencies and service providers.
- Support adults to achieve positive outcomes whilst promoting independence and wellbeing.
- Maintain accurate and timely case recordings and reports.
- Qualified Social Worker.
- Registered with Social Care Wales.
- Experience working within Adult Social Care.
- Knowledge of safeguarding procedures and relevant legislation.
- Experience working with individuals with mental health needs.
- Strong assessment, communication and partnership-working skills.
- Ability to manage a varied and complex caseload.
- Full-time office attendance required during induction.
- Following induction, a hybrid working arrangement is available, with 3 to 4 days per week in the office and 1 to 2 days working remotely, subject to suitability and service requirements.
